日B视频 亚洲,啪啪啪网站一区二区,91色情精品久久,日日噜狠狠色综合久,超碰人妻少妇97在线,999青青视频,亚洲一区二卡,让本一区二区视频,日韩网站推荐

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內(nèi)不再提示

嵌入式系統(tǒng)設計將如何訪問存儲設備

星星科技指導員 ? 來源:嵌入式計算設計 ? 作者:Yaniv Iarovici ? 2022-10-18 11:40 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

據(jù)IDC稱,到2025年,物聯(lián)網(wǎng)設備將產(chǎn)生超過73澤字節(jié)(ZB)的數(shù)據(jù)。

換句話說,隨著物聯(lián)網(wǎng)熱潮的繼續(xù),這些設備將產(chǎn)生一波巨大的數(shù)據(jù)浪潮,這些數(shù)據(jù)將需要被引導、處理和存儲。

這個問題不僅限于任何一個行業(yè)。根據(jù)研究公司Yole Développement的數(shù)據(jù),汽車制造商在2021年安裝了40億千兆字節(jié)(GB)的基于NAND的存儲,到2024年可能需要160億GB,到2028年可能需要780億GB。與此同時,西部數(shù)據(jù)估計,到2020年,智能手機用戶產(chǎn)生的存儲工作負載高達每位用戶每天30GB,高于2015年的每天不到15GB。

規(guī)劃嵌入式存儲

一個簡單的事實是,現(xiàn)代的、永遠在線的、完全數(shù)字化的世界依賴于大量的數(shù)據(jù)。嵌入式系統(tǒng)的開發(fā)人員和系統(tǒng)架構(gòu)師需要從產(chǎn)品開發(fā)過程的一開始就考慮存儲需求,無論其行業(yè)如何。

這不僅僅是關于數(shù)量 - 盡管這顯然是一個重要的考慮因素。存儲用戶需要評估性能(讀/寫操作的速度)和可靠性,以減少平均故障間隔時間 (MTBF)??煽啃缘囊徊糠峙c耐用性有關,耐用性本質(zhì)上是在設備生命周期內(nèi)寫入和重寫大量數(shù)據(jù)的能力。用戶在選擇存儲時,還必須考慮其設計或產(chǎn)品的特定連接性和容量需求。

讓我們從連接性開始。在開發(fā)非嵌入式、依賴于云的應用程序時,存儲相對容易解決:只需分配更多 S3 存儲桶即可。要是物聯(lián)網(wǎng)中這么簡單就好了。的確,對于長期存儲,來自物聯(lián)網(wǎng)設備的數(shù)據(jù)可以像任何其他位一樣存儲在云中。云是物聯(lián)網(wǎng)等式的重要組成部分,但它不是一站式商店。

云存儲取決于設備連接到云的能力,在許多應用程序中,網(wǎng)絡連接不是給定的。地下深處或遠在海上的設備可能會長時間斷開互聯(lián)網(wǎng),從而無法訪問云存儲。對于依賴嵌入式傳感器自動駕駛汽車,無線連接的延遲和間歇性可能會帶來不可接受的風險。對于此類設備,板載存儲更快,更可靠。

對于嵌入式設備,耐用性比位于數(shù)據(jù)中心的個人移動設備或系統(tǒng)要大,因為更換非常簡單。更換位于離地面300米的天線尖端或海上鉆機深水下的設備中的存儲單元要困難得多。因此,設計人員希望選擇能夠持續(xù)很長時間的存儲,無論是在耐用性(許多讀/寫周期)方面,還是在設備使用壽命期間可能需要的容量方面。

正確測量耐久性

存儲設備的耐用性是通過您可以寫入它的數(shù)據(jù)量(以 TB 為單位)來衡量的。寫入的 TB 數(shù) (TBW) 限制因存儲類型而異,因此需要根據(jù)預期的實際工作負荷估計數(shù)據(jù)寫入要求。

另一個需要考慮的重要項目是寫入放大因子 (WAF)。WAF 是實際寫入 NAND 的數(shù)據(jù)量與系統(tǒng)發(fā)送到 NAND 的數(shù)據(jù)量的對比。如果設備接收到大量不會填滿內(nèi)存頁的數(shù)據(jù)寫入,則這兩個數(shù)字可能會有所不同。這會導致分散在許多不同頁面上的存儲空間,只能通過移動數(shù)據(jù)來釋放這些空間(類似于對硬盤驅(qū)動器進行碎片整理)。移動該數(shù)據(jù)的過程會占用額外的寫入操作。

這意味著,如果主機向支持汽車應用程序的存儲設備發(fā)送50TB的數(shù)據(jù),并且設備必須移動大量數(shù)據(jù)才能有效地填充內(nèi)存頁,從而產(chǎn)生3.0的WAF,則NAND的實際TBW為150TB。顯然,這將導致NAND的使用壽命比您期望的WAF為1.0時短得多。在主機端可以做一些事情來解決這個問題,但是如果你計算不正確,在這種情況下,實際使用壽命可能只有1/3,并可能導致系統(tǒng)意外故障。這只是系統(tǒng)設計人員需要知道汽車將如何訪問存儲設備并考慮產(chǎn)品壽命的另一個原因。

針對 IIoT 設計存儲

工業(yè)設備有其獨特的要求,這些要求將根據(jù)具體應用而有所不同。

環(huán)境:設備將在什么環(huán)境中運行?可能影響存儲設備的可靠性和性能的環(huán)境條件包括海拔高度、溫度、濕度和振動。高壓和加速度也可能發(fā)揮作用。確保您使用的存儲在其預期環(huán)境中的額定值適合運行,或者對于將來可能遇到的環(huán)境,該存儲經(jīng)得起未來考驗。

耐力:您可以向設備寫入多少數(shù)據(jù)?如上所述,考慮設備的壽命很重要,但寫入頻率也很重要。新的工作負載通常需要能夠長時間支持連續(xù)讀取和寫入操作的存儲。更高的耐用性將減少所需的維護量。

數(shù)據(jù)保留:您需要將數(shù)據(jù)可靠地存儲多長時間?數(shù)據(jù)是在端點、在“邊緣”設備附近的現(xiàn)場設備中還是在云中進行處理和分析?對于某些工業(yè)應用,您需要將數(shù)據(jù)保留更長時間:例如,在農(nóng)業(yè)或天氣應用中,您可能需要將數(shù)據(jù)保留數(shù)月或數(shù)年,以便比較季節(jié)性溫度模式。您的存儲解決方案需要能夠根據(jù)應用程序和組織(或行業(yè))的數(shù)據(jù)保留策略,根據(jù)需要保留數(shù)據(jù)。

遠程監(jiān)控:IIoT 設備并不總是很容易訪問。您如何監(jiān)控這些設備以確保它們正常運行,或在缺陷實際發(fā)生之前預測缺陷?監(jiān)控和預測性維護已經(jīng)是生產(chǎn)設備的常見考慮因素,它們對于IIoT設備和支持它們的存儲也很重要。

汽車應用中的存儲

用于乘用車、卡車或其他車輛的嵌入式設備需要足夠堅固,以承受各種環(huán)境,以及灰塵、污垢、振動和加速。此外,安全問題和法規(guī)可能會施加自己獨特的要求。以下是汽車行業(yè)的一些存儲注意事項。

汽車級:在開發(fā)用于汽車的嵌入式設備時,汽車級存儲是必須的。這些設備需要承受更寬的溫度范圍,從-40C到105C。為了滿足汽車行業(yè)的嚴格要求,這些存儲單元將經(jīng)過廣泛的測試,以確保它們不易發(fā)生故障。

接口:汽車器件的設計人員可以使用各種存儲接口,包括標清、MMC、UFS 和 PCIe。使用哪一個將取決于所使用的 SoC。但性能要求也會影響此選擇。

例如,對于不需要超高速讀取和寫入的應用,e.MMC將是一個不錯的選擇,并且可以幫助避免高性能設計帶來的路由和信號完整性挑戰(zhàn)。UFS是性能的下一步,并且越來越受歡迎。PCIe 即將出現(xiàn),將是支持高性能應用程序的不錯選擇。

耐力:最后,在汽車中,就像在IIoT中一樣,耐用性也很重要。車輛會產(chǎn)生大量數(shù)據(jù),這可能導致大量的讀取和寫入操作。確保正在使用的存儲的 TBW 容量適合你正在構(gòu)建的設備的預期壽命。

元宇宙及其他領域的存儲

您可能不認為嵌入式設備在元宇宙中會發(fā)揮重要作用,但它們確實如此 - 從用于真正沉浸式虛擬現(xiàn)實(VR)體驗的3D耳機到更便攜的眼鏡,當用戶在現(xiàn)實世界中走動時提供增強現(xiàn)實(AR)體驗。這些設備利用嵌入式存儲,這帶來了自己的一系列考慮因素。

功耗:雖然我們?nèi)蕴幱贏R和VR設備開發(fā)的早期階段,但有一些一般準則。這些設備中的存儲將在很大程度上借鑒智能手機等移動設備的要求。功耗至關重要,因為它會影響電池壽命 - 這是消費者的主要關注點。

重量:在 AR 中,體重可能變得異常顯著。對于眼鏡等可穿戴設備,每一克都很重要。如果你的眼鏡只有12克重,即使增加一兩克也是一個明顯的差異。存儲設備的外形尺寸和尺寸會影響其重量,應予以考慮。

無論我們是否都會戴著AR眼鏡四處走動,有一件事是明確的:嵌入式計算的行業(yè)和用例的范圍正在不斷擴大。這意味著數(shù)據(jù)量將繼續(xù)增加,隨之而來的是對更多存儲的需求,以及比以往更快、更持久、更能抵抗環(huán)境因素的存儲。嵌入式系統(tǒng)設計人員最好不要讓存儲成為事后的想法,并在規(guī)劃下一代物聯(lián)網(wǎng)時從一開始就考慮存儲。

審核編輯:郭婷

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權轉(zhuǎn)載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學習之用,如有內(nèi)容侵權或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    嵌入式以太網(wǎng)原型開發(fā)套件:探索嵌入式系統(tǒng)編程的理想選擇

    包含了眾多實用的組件,能幫助工程師們更高效地進行嵌入式系統(tǒng)的開發(fā)與調(diào)試。 文件下載: 53320-603.pdf 套件內(nèi)容一覽 存儲存儲盒的存在看似簡單,實則非常重要。它為套件中的
    的頭像 發(fā)表于 05-13 13:50 ?72次閱讀

    高速存儲器sram芯片嵌入式系統(tǒng)應用

    嵌入式系統(tǒng)設計中,存儲器的性能往往直接決定了整個系統(tǒng)的響應速度與穩(wěn)定性。對于需要額外擴展數(shù)據(jù)緩存、但又受限于板載RAM資源的工程師而言,高速存儲
    的頭像 發(fā)表于 05-12 16:54 ?305次閱讀

    低功耗psram在嵌入式存儲領域的作用

    嵌入式存儲領域,低功耗PSRAM(偽靜態(tài)隨機存取存儲器)正逐漸成為智能穿戴、物聯(lián)網(wǎng)設備等對功耗和體積敏感應用的理想選擇。
    的頭像 發(fā)表于 04-03 11:29 ?311次閱讀
    低功耗psram在<b class='flag-5'>嵌入式</b><b class='flag-5'>存儲</b>領域的作用

    嵌入式系統(tǒng)安全設計原則

    隨著物聯(lián)網(wǎng)、工業(yè)控制和智能設備的普及,嵌入式系統(tǒng)的安全問題越來越突出。一個小小的漏洞,就可能導致設備被入侵、數(shù)據(jù)泄露,甚至對人身安全產(chǎn)生威脅。因此,從設計階段開始就考慮安全,是每一個
    的頭像 發(fā)表于 01-19 09:06 ?543次閱讀
    <b class='flag-5'>嵌入式</b><b class='flag-5'>系統(tǒng)</b>安全設計原則

    什么是嵌入式應用開發(fā)?

    系統(tǒng)中,用于控制、監(jiān)測或通信等特定用途。與一般計算機系統(tǒng)不同,嵌入式系統(tǒng)通常具有較小的存儲容量、處理能力和功耗,且需要滿足特定的實時性、可靠
    發(fā)表于 01-12 16:13

    什么是嵌入式操作系統(tǒng)?

    嵌入式操作系統(tǒng)的定義 嵌入式操作系統(tǒng)是專門為資源受限的嵌入式設備(比如 STM32 單片機、
    發(fā)表于 12-09 10:33

    嵌入式系統(tǒng)軟件架構(gòu)通常劃分

    嵌入式系統(tǒng)的軟件架構(gòu)通常劃分如下分層設計: 應用層:環(huán)境溫度監(jiān)測、報警觸發(fā)邏輯。 中間件層:支持MQTT協(xié)議的網(wǎng)絡通信模塊,用于將溫度數(shù)據(jù)上傳至云端。 操作系統(tǒng)層:基于FreeRTOS進行多任務管理
    發(fā)表于 12-01 07:20

    C語言在嵌入式開發(fā)中的應用

    C 語言在汽車電子控制系統(tǒng)開發(fā)中的主導地位。 2、設備驅(qū)動程序 設備驅(qū)動程序是嵌入式系統(tǒng)中連接硬件和軟件的橋梁,它負責實現(xiàn)
    發(fā)表于 11-21 08:09

    嵌入式和FPGA的區(qū)別

    開發(fā)中做出更明智的技術選擇。 基本概念解析 嵌入式系統(tǒng)(Embedded System)是一種專用計算機系統(tǒng),通常包含微處理器/微控制器、存儲器和專用外圍
    發(fā)表于 11-19 06:55

    嵌入式系統(tǒng)的定義和應用領域

    嵌入式系統(tǒng),簡而言之,就是一種專為特定設備或裝置設計的計算機系統(tǒng)。它們通常配備一個嵌入式處理器,其控制程序被
    發(fā)表于 11-17 06:49

    嵌入式開發(fā)的關鍵點介紹

    。 嵌入式開發(fā)的關鍵點: 1. 硬件限制: 嵌入式系統(tǒng)通常具有嚴格的硬件限制,例如處理器速度、內(nèi)存和存儲容量等。因此,嵌入式開發(fā)需要考慮這些
    發(fā)表于 11-13 08:12

    嵌入式實時操作系統(tǒng)的特點

    操作系統(tǒng)具備高效的中斷處理機制,能夠快速響應和處理系統(tǒng)的中斷事件。 資源管理:實時嵌入式操作系統(tǒng)提供有效的資源管理機制,包括內(nèi)存管理、設備驅(qū)
    發(fā)表于 11-13 06:30

    廣州郵科嵌入式通信電源系統(tǒng):提升通信設備穩(wěn)定性與效率的關鍵

    在今天的信息化社會,嵌入式通信電源系統(tǒng)已經(jīng)成為許多通信設備的核心組成部分。特別是在廣州郵科,嵌入式通信電源系統(tǒng)不僅確保了
    的頭像 發(fā)表于 08-30 11:01 ?800次閱讀
    廣州郵科<b class='flag-5'>嵌入式</b>通信電源<b class='flag-5'>系統(tǒng)</b>:提升通信<b class='flag-5'>設備</b>穩(wěn)定性與效率的關鍵

    入行嵌入式應該怎么準備?

    架構(gòu)、總線協(xié)議和存儲器管理等概念的理解也是必不可少的。 三、操作系統(tǒng)嵌入式系統(tǒng)通常需要運行一個實時操作系統(tǒng)(RTOS)或者一個精簡版的操作
    發(fā)表于 08-06 10:34

    Linux嵌入式和單片機嵌入式的區(qū)別?

    Linux嵌入式與單片機嵌入式在多個方面存在顯著的區(qū)別,以下是詳細的比較和歸納: 一、基本概念 1. Linux嵌入式: 定義:將Linux操作系統(tǒng)運行在
    發(fā)表于 06-20 09:46
    芒康县| 乐山市| 平顺县| 涞水县| 基隆市| 定日县| 平顶山市| 分宜县| 平泉县| 沙雅县| 双柏县| 临猗县| 湾仔区| 芜湖市| 卓尼县| 大丰市| 枣庄市| 平昌县| 安远县| 炉霍县| 镇原县| 临颍县| 沂南县| 始兴县| 绩溪县| 惠州市| 修文县| 庆阳市| 鱼台县| 新乐市| 安仁县| 得荣县| 乐至县| 珲春市| 裕民县| 托克托县| 叶城县| 新密市| 五指山市| 东光县| 珲春市|